×

Common Causes of Data Loss in the FM25V05-GTR Flash Memory Chip

blog2 blog2 Posted in2025-04-29 03:42:51 Views5 Comments0

Take the sofaComment

Common Causes of Data Loss in the FM25V05-GTR Flash Memory Chip

Common Causes of Data Loss in the FM25V05-G TR Flash Memory Chip: Troubleshooting and Solutions

The FM25V05-GTR Flash Memory Chip is a popular non-volatile memory solution commonly used in electronic devices. However, like any technology, it is susceptible to certain issues that can result in data loss. Understanding these causes and how to address them can help in ensuring the integrity and longevity of your device. Below, we’ll go through some of the common causes of data loss, the reasons behind them, and step-by-step solutions to resolve the issues.

1. Power Failures During Data Writing

Cause: One of the most common reasons for data loss in flash memory chips is a sudden power failure while the chip is in the process of writing or storing data. If power is cut off abruptly, the data that was being written may become corrupted or lost.

Solution: To prevent this, consider adding a power-loss detection circuit or a capacitor that ensures the device can complete its write operation before losing power. In case of an unexpected power failure, try the following:

Step 1: Check the power supply to ensure it is stable and sufficient. Step 2: Use a proper voltage regulator and include an uninterruptible power supply (UPS) system if necessary. Step 3: If data corruption occurs, attempt to re-flash the chip using a backup image or software tool specifically designed for recovering corrupted flash memory data. 2. Write Endurance Limitations

Cause: Flash memory chips have a finite number of write and erase cycles, which is referred to as write endurance. After a certain number of write cycles, the cells in the memory may wear out and become unreliable, leading to data loss.

Solution: To extend the life of the FM25V05-GTR chip and avoid data loss due to wear:

Step 1: Regularly monitor the number of write cycles on the chip. Step 2: Implement a wear leveling technique, which ensures that write operations are evenly distributed across the memory cells, reducing wear on any single cell. Step 3: Replace the memory chip if it approaches its write endurance limit, or implement periodic backup processes to prevent data loss. 3. Electrical Overstress (EOS)

Cause: Exposure to excessive voltage or current can cause permanent damage to the chip’s internal circuits, leading to failure and data loss. This could happen due to power surges or incorrect handling of the device.

Solution: Prevent electrical overstress by taking the following precautions:

Step 1: Use voltage protection circuits such as transient voltage suppressors ( TVS ) diodes or surge protectors to shield the memory from voltage spikes. Step 2: Ensure the device is operating within its specified voltage range (typically 3.3V or 5V for FM25V05-GTR) to avoid overstressing the memory. Step 3: If EOS occurs, inspect the chip for visible damage and replace it if necessary. If the data is lost, attempt data recovery using any available backup or reprogramming tools. 4. Incorrect Programming or Erasure

Cause: Improper programming or erasure of memory cells can result in data corruption. For example, writing incorrect data patterns or using incompatible software tools may cause the data to be written incorrectly, leading to loss or corruption.

Solution: To prevent data loss due to programming errors:

Step 1: Ensure that you are using the correct and verified programming tools or software designed for the FM25V05-GTR. Step 2: Double-check the programming sequence before initiating any write or erase operations. Step 3: If data corruption occurs, try using software tools that can check and repair memory contents. If recovery is impossible, restore from backups or attempt reprogramming with the correct data. 5. Physical Damage

Cause: Physical damage to the chip, such as from electrostatic discharge (ESD), impacts from external forces, or improper installation, can result in internal damage and data loss.

Solution: To avoid physical damage:

Step 1: Handle the memory chip carefully and use ESD protection during installation or maintenance to prevent damage from electrostatic discharges. Step 2: Ensure proper installation with correct orientation and soldering to avoid mechanical stress on the chip. Step 3: In case of physical damage, inspect the chip for signs of physical failure, such as cracks or broken pins. If the chip is damaged, replace it and restore data from backups. 6. Environmental Factors

Cause: Environmental factors, such as extreme temperatures or humidity, can affect the stability and performance of flash memory chips. The FM25V05-GTR, like all memory chips, has an operating temperature range, and exceeding this range can result in data corruption or loss.

Solution: To mitigate the risk from environmental factors:

Step 1: Ensure the device is operated within the specified temperature and humidity ranges provided in the datasheet. Step 2: If operating in extreme environments, consider using temperature-controlled environments or cooling systems to maintain stable operating conditions. Step 3: If environmental conditions are suspected to cause data loss, check the device for signs of overheating or condensation and move it to a more controlled environment. 7. Software or Firmware Bugs

Cause: Bugs in the software or firmware controlling the memory chip can also lead to data loss. For example, errors in the memory management software might cause data to be written incorrectly or overwrite valid data.

Solution: To prevent software-related issues:

Step 1: Regularly update the device’s firmware and software to ensure compatibility and to patch any known bugs. Step 2: Test new software and firmware in a controlled environment before deploying them to avoid unexpected data loss. Step 3: If a bug is suspected, roll back to a previous version of the software or firmware and contact the manufacturer for a fix or update.

Conclusion

Data loss in the FM25V05-GTR Flash Memory Chip can occur due to a variety of factors, including power failures, write endurance issues, electrical overstress, programming errors, physical damage, environmental conditions, and software bugs. By following these troubleshooting steps and taking preventive measures, you can minimize the risk of data loss and ensure the continued reliability of your flash memory chip. Regular maintenance, proper handling, and effective backup strategies are essential to maintaining data integrity.

IC Clouds | Leading innovation platform for electronic technology, providing comprehensive IC application and design resources

icclouds

Anonymous